SPQR ‎– SPQR LXFormat: CD, Limited Edition, Numbered, ReissueCountry: ItalyReleased: 16 Jul 2021Style: Experimental, Industrial Live at Piper is the first official live performance of this legendary occult/esoteric band from Rome. In the year 1986 their gig was not very well received by the audience. First Korg synthetizer and ritual percussions made this concert a very unique and incredible experience. For the first time is now available digitally remastered in an special eco digipack cd, limited to 616 copies.
